Iraqis to Write Iraqi constitution

Appointed Minister of Justice, Hashim Abdel Rahman Chalabi, said in Bahrain according to al-Hayat that the new Iraqi constitution would be entirely the creation of Iraqis, and that no foreign jurists would be involved in drafting it. After the story we just heard about the commercial laws, one wonders whether such categorical statements have much credibility. Meanwhile, the temporary president of the Interim Governing Council, Ahmad Chalabi, stopped in Kuwait on his way to the UN and promised the Kuwaitis that the new Iraq recognizes them and their border in accordance with UN resolutions.
